Damico International Shipping S.A. (OTC: DMCOF) is an established player in the global shipping industry, primarily involved in the transportation of refined petroleum products. The company operates a fleet of modern vessels, which are strategically designed to meet the needs of the evolving energy sector. Damico is headquartered in Monaco and has built a reputation for its operational efficiency and commitment to safety, key attributes in a highly competitive market.
In recent years, Damico has focused on expanding its fleet and enhancing its service offerings, positioning itself to capitalize on growing demand for energy transportation. The company aims to leverage its expertise and network to secure long-term contracts, which can provide revenue stability amidst the cyclical nature of the shipping industry. The company's fleet primarily consists of medium-range (MR) tankers, which are versatile and capable of accessing various ports, thus allowing flexibility and operational efficiency.
Financially, Damico has shown resilience despite the challenges posed by fluctuating oil prices and increasing environmental regulations affecting the shipping sector. The company has demonstrated an ability to manage its debt levels and operate profitably, which is critical for navigating market volatility. Furthermore, Damico is positioning itself to adapt to increasing environmental scrutiny by exploring new technologies and practices that could minimize its carbon footprint.
Looking ahead, Damico International Shipping S.A. is well-placed to take advantage of the anticipated rebound in global oil demand, particularly as economies recover post-pandemic. Continued investment in fleet modernization and strategic partnerships will be essential for the firm's growth trajectory. As the company navigates the complexities of the shipping landscape, its operational agility and commitment to sustainability will be pivotal in ensuring long-term success.

d'Amico International Shipping SA is an international marine transportation company. It provides transportation services for refined petroleum products and vegetable oil. It operates a flexible fleet of product/chemical tankers. The product tankers transport refined oil products through various double-hulled vessels. It serves oil companies and trading houses. Its revenue is generated from the employment of the vessels of its fleet under spot contracts and time charters, for the marine transportation of refined petroleum products. Geographically the activities are performed throughout Luxembourg.
